Food Waste awareness and The Felix Project Food waste is a highly significant environmental crisis we face. The Felix Project is a food distribution charity that fights both food waste and hunger in London. 1.5 million adults in London struggle to afford to eat every day and 400,000 children are at risk of missing the next meal. Meanwhile, our food industry generates 3 million tonnes of good, edible surplus food each year, which has significant damaging impacts on the environment. The Felix Project collects food from supermarkets, restaurants and wholesalers that would be going to waste and delivers the food to homeless shelters, schools where pupils may not have stable food supply and houses for vulnerable people. In 2020 they provided 21.1 million meals to the vulnerable. Thanks to the Felix team food that would have normally gone straight to landfill is reaching those who really need it.
